(To select more than one, hold down the Ctrl key as you click, or you can select a range of photos by shift-clicking.) Click the pictures you want to print as thumbnails.Navigate to the place where the pictures are that you want to print and open the folder. Open the Pictures library by clicking the Start button and then clicking Pictures.Here’s how to print a “contact sheet” in Windows 7: (see update for Windows 10 at bottom of post) It’s easy, and you don’t need any special photo software. Even though I have my photos pretty well organized on my computer, I like to have stuff on a piece of paper I can scribble on. Whatever you call them, contact sheets can be a big help in keeping track of what photos to use in a life story or family history book/project. Have you ever thought how handy it would be to have a printout of itty-bitty pictures, with their filenames, of all the photos in a particular file? Photographers call them "contact sheets " the ones you get with your photo prints from Costco are called "index prints.
